City Government Encounter

On 12th November, the first day of the Sharing Cities Summit, is held in Disseny Hub the City Government Encounter: an opportunity for city representatives from around the globe to discuss new policies and propose actions regarding platform economy.

 

50 cities atend this encounter: Amsterdam, Athens, Atlanta, Almere, Bethlehem, Bilbao, Bologna, Buenos Aires, Bordeaux, Bristol, Eindhoven, el Prat de Llobregat, Fez, Ghent, Gothenburg, Grenoble, The Hague, Kobe, La Coruña, Lisboa, Madrid, Malmö, Maribor, Melbourne, Milan, Montreal, Montreuil, New York City, Paris, Prague, Seoul, Tel Aviv, Toronto, Umeå, Valencia, Vienna, San Francisco, Stockholm, Muscat, Sao Paulo, Santiago de Compostela, Singapur, Montelíbano, Taipei, Reykjavik, Rijswijk and Vitoria – Gasteiz.

Cities representatives explain their different approaches, sensitivities and priorities towards platform economy. Apart from debating about promoting platforms based on socially responsible models, the main objective of this encounter is to propose a Common Declaration of Principles and Commitments for Sharing Cities. The cities which agree on the principles proposed in the Declaration, also agree on implementing a common negotiation framework.
